Default ignition rod came loose help

It is a 91 C4 and the rod that goes from the key tumbler to the ignition switch on the bottom of the column came loose. I have taken the steering column apart as far as I want to right now and can not see how the rod connects on the top side. It is apart to were I can see the plunger that the lock set rotates. Any where to get a parts break down or anyone who has done this before? Am somewhat mechanical but never messed with steering column stuff before so am a little scared to get to far in without some pictures or guidance.

dimmer isn't to bad, had to remove it to get to the ignition switch but my son had the best idea so far -- remove the steering column and do it on the bench. My Chilton's has steps for that and it looks fairly straight forward so am going to try it that way. Thanks for the advice
